The College of Nursing has an opening for tenure track (T/TE) position.
Join the prestigious University of Arizona, a renowned research institution at the forefront of health sciences teaching and scholarship. Our College of Nursing is highly esteemed, accredited by the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education, and ranks among the top four percent of graduate nursing programs in the United States.
As part of the University of Arizona Health Sciences, one of the five colleges shaping the future of healthcare, the College of Nursing offers a wealth of educational resources. Our partnership with Banner - University Medical Center and Phoenix Biomedical Campus provides unparalleled clinical and research opportunities, fostering an environment where innovation and excellence thrive.

- Develop and maintain an extramurally funded program of research.
- Disseminate scholarship (teaching, research, and/or practice/service) intra and inter professionally.
- Translate scholarship for practice or policy improvement.
- Serve or develop as a master teacher in the classroom, laboratory, or field sites.
- Serve as a research mentor to graduate students and undergraduate honors students.
- Serve as a mentor to and/or collaborator for peer faculty in their teaching, research and practice/service.
- Participate in faculty governance of the College and University.
- Provide professional leadership within regional, local, national and international nursing and multidisciplinary groups.
- Possession of a doctoral degree in Nursing or any health-related field by date of hire.
- Evidence of funded research and/or research training and publications.
- Previous teaching experience at the graduate level.
- Strong research background with supporting evidence.
- Eligible for entry level licensure in Arizona if Registered Nurse.

Associate Professors usually advance by expanding their research portfolio, securing external funding, and demonstrating leadership in mentoring and academic governance. Success in interdisciplinary collaboration and translating scholarship into clinical practice are also key factors influencing upward mobility.
Assistant Professors focus heavily on developing a research agenda, engaging in graduate teaching, and starting mentorship roles. Unlike senior colleagues, they often balance establishing independent scholarship with growing involvement in service activities within their institution and professional communities.

Tenure-track nursing faculty salaries in Tucson generally range between $85,000 and $130,000 annually, varying by rank and experience. Competitive compensation reflects the region's cost of living and the university’s status as a leading research institution within health sciences.
